Handover Note — Project Larkspur Delay

Passing Larkspur over to you in slightly rough shape, I'm afraid. The integration phase slipped two quarters after the Vensall platform migration stalled, and the board is understandably twitchy. Key contacts and open risks are in the shared tracker. One last thing worth flagging before you take the reins is set out below.

board note of bawep-tajef: Queniusek Systems plans to raise the Quenvan list price by 53.1 percent in March. The pricing group signed off on a budget of $176.4 million for Project Drueth. The renewal with Casionix Partners closes at $142.5 million a year, 8.3 percent below the last contract. Project Fraax slips by six weeks because of the tooling delay.

## Artifact Signing — Renderwell Pipeline

Every markdown bundle produced by the Renderwell pipeline must be signed before promotion to the Quillgate CDN. The signer runs as the `rw-sign` sidecar; if it crashes, rendered pages will serve stale. Verify the checksum manifest first, then re-sign manually. For manual signing, use the current release key shown below.

deploy key for kajof-fajop: bky6_gDHw9Q

Zero-downtime schema migrations on Pellworth follow the expand-migrate-contract pattern. First, add new columns as nullable and deploy code that writes to both old and new fields. Backfill in batches of 10k rows via the Copperline job runner, monitoring replica lag throughout. Only after verification do we flip reads to the new columns and drop the old ones in a later release. Each phase is gated behind a feature flag. The most recent successful dry run was recorded under the token below.

build token for kajeg-bageg: htk6_abeb3e

Subject: Key rotation for InvoiceForge renderer

Welcome, new folks. Every quarter we rotate the credential the Pellworth PDF invoice renderer uses to call our internal asset service, Vaultline. The old key stops working Friday at noon. Update your local .env and the staging config before then, and verify a test invoice renders with the new embedded fonts. For convenience, the freshly issued key is included here.

app token of bagef-bageg = kto11_vuwA0uhrEMg